Subject: [RFC v2 0/3] Support perf stat with i915 PMU
Date: Wed, 23 Aug 2017 08:26:00 -0700 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1503501963-24136-1-git-send-email-dmitry.v.rogozhkin@intel.com> (raw)
These patches depend on the RFC patches enabling i915 PMU from Tvrtko:
https://patchwork.freedesktop.org/series/27488/
Thus, CI failure to build them is expected. I think that my patches should
be squeashed in Tvrtko's one actually.
The first patch simply reorders functions and does nothing comparing to
Tvrtko's patches. Next patches add fixes according to PMU API comments
and clarifications from PMU aware engineers.
v1: Make busy_stats refcounted instead of the whole pmu.
v2: Expose cpumask for the i915 pmu to prevent creation of multiple events
of the same type. Remove perf-driver level sampling.
